The means shown for moving the illuminating chamber E toward and from the cylinder consist of a pair of screws M se cured to the ends of the chamber and havmg screwthresded engagements with the hubs of bevel gears m which are suitably jO'llIIlflled on the front portion a o'lt'the main frame. Each of these wheels com.
--nested by bevel gears n to a cross shaft n andby bevel. gears n to the operating shaft m so that both illuminating chambers are moved simultaneously and correspondingly by turning this shaft 122*. Suitable mechafnism of other construction for moving the illuminating chambers'toward and from the cylinder could be employed. In the use of the machine, the cylinder carris e is moved by its sd'ustin mocha-- 2' C3 nism toward one end of the machine until it iswithdrswn from between the ill umi muting chambers, the shaft I) is moved to release the cylinder and the pivoted cylinder support c is swung around to a crosswise position'inthe carriage. The cylinder is then placed inthe pivoted support c, end the letter is swung back parallel With the carriage C and is locked by moving' the shaft D again into engagement with the cylinder journal. The cylinder is now adjusted so that the printing films or sheets 7 stand opposite to those portions of the sensitizcd surface upon which the prints are to hemsde, and for thispurpose the mcchw nisms for nd uStmg the cylinder clrcnn'r ferentially and lengthwise are resorted to as may be necessary. When the cylinder has been properly flfljllSlGd, the illuminating chambers are moved by the described mechanism to press the printing films or sheets against lllGmSQllSli-lZQd cylindrical surface. The exposure is then made and the chambers with the printing films or "sheets are withdrawn from the cylinder the latter isremovedfrom the machine and the sensitized surface is finished for pr'intin :in'any suitable or Well-known manner, or, when the prints are being made on one-half vonly of the cylinder, the cylinder can be suitably adjusted for printing in a correspending. position on the other half of the cylinder.

The combination of acylinder cnrria ge, s cylinder supportpivoted in said carriage, a cylinder provided with a, sensitized surface and rotutably mounted on said support, an illuminating: chamber adapted to press a printing film or sheet againstthe sensitized surface, and means for adjusting said cerrings lengthwise relative to said chamber, substantially as set forth;

The combination of a cylinder carriage, a cylinder support pivoted in said earring a cylinoer prorided with a sensitized surface and rotatably and rcmovsbly mounted on said support, an illuminating chamber, means for moving said chamber toward said cylinder to press a printing film or sheet against the sensitized surface, and means 1 for adjusting said carriage lengthwise relstive to said chamber, substantially as set forth.
